Corn is a demanding cereal crop in terms of temperature, it is thermophilic, it likes temperatures above 16 degrees Celsius, and the optimal temperature is 22°C.
Corn sprouts evenly at a temperature of 9 - 10 °C.
The corn germination process takes place in the soil at temperatures of 6 degrees Celsius. Corn is resistant to frost down to -3°C. The phases from flowering to ripening are not so demanding when it comes to temperatures.
It is not a cereal that requires a lot of irrigation because it has a well-developed root system, which is why it tolerates drought or water shortages more easily. However, during flowering, i.e. in July and early August, it requires more irrigation.
It is recommended to grow corn in an agricultural system called monoculture for 3-4 years in a row. Corn sowing should start in the second half of April in the southwestern part of Poland, from April 25 to May 5 in the southeastern regions, and until May 10 in other parts. The proper time of sowing corn seeds guarantees better development of the root system and, consequently, higher yields.
